The
Andy Dye Course at Eagle Ridge was originally
laid out to maximum advantage of the spectacular
natural canyon winding through the course
from "tip to tip" using traditional
and classic golf design with the fundamental
elements of risk and reward decision in shot
making and its execution. The entire 18 holes
are working together, offering unlimited,
balanced and complimentary shot selection,
creativity and mental discipline.
The
natural canyon is fully utilized to enhance
the design of each individual golf hole, as
shots accurately and boldly struck neat the
canyon edge. It offers significant advantages
in distance and angle of approach over the
shots played wide and safe of the canyon.
It is risk and reward golf with such a dramatic
and sometimes psychologically imposing natural
feature. Bold & Beautiful!
